Which Metals Are Commonly Employed in Foundry Services?

Foundry operations commonly employ a variety of metals, including bronze, steel, cast iron, and aluminum. These materials are selected for their particular properties, which contribute to the strength, durability, and performance of the final cast products.

How Should I Pick the Right Foundry Service Provider?

To choose the right foundry service provider, one should examine their experience, technology, quality certifications, and customer reviews. Assessing pricing and lead times can also guarantee alignment with specific project requirements and expectations.

What Are the Main Challenges Found in Foundry Services?

Common challenges in foundry services include inconsistent material quality, equipment maintenance issues, labor shortages, fluctuating raw material costs, and regulatory compliance. These factors can substantially impact production effectiveness and the overall quality of metal castings.

How Much Time Does the Foundry Process Typically Require?

The foundry procedure generally requires anywhere from weeks to months, determined by the complexity of the design, material type, and volume of production. Elements like mold creation and final processing steps can significantly impact the complete schedule.
